Transaction 22feb590b6c7abb7a1b63553b39b6baa36eb5b57bec0cae0503faa36bbda97ce
1 Input
1 Output
-
22feb590b6c7abb7a1b63553b39b6baa36eb5b57bec0cae0503faa36bbda97ce:0
- value
- 13023350
- script pubkey
- OP_0 OP_PUSHBYTES_20 f0850baacc6f0a3dbf92c219a553d0b23d1edba8
- address
- bc1q7zzsh2kvdu9rm0ujcgv6257skg73akagupyu3x